当前位置: 首页 > news >正文

手机网站开发制作网站是每年都要付费吗

手机网站开发制作,网站是每年都要付费吗,dux5.3 wordpress,上海网站建设那家好1822. 数组元素积的符号 已知函数 signFunc(x) 将会根据 x 的正负返回特定值#xff1a; 如果 x 是正数#xff0c;返回 1 。 如果 x 是负数#xff0c;返回 -1 。 如果 x 是等于 0 #xff0c;返回 0 。 给你一个整数数组 nums 。令 product 为数组 nums 中所有元素值的…1822. 数组元素积的符号 已知函数 signFunc(x) 将会根据 x 的正负返回特定值 如果 x 是正数返回 1 。 如果 x 是负数返回 -1 。 如果 x 是等于 0 返回 0 。 给你一个整数数组 nums 。令 product 为数组 nums 中所有元素值的乘积。 返回 signFunc(product) 。 示例 1输入nums [-1,-2,-3,-4,3,2,1] 输出1 解释数组中所有值的乘积是 144 且 signFunc(144) 1示例 2输入nums [1,5,0,2,-3] 输出0 解释数组中所有值的乘积是 0 且 signFunc(0) 0示例 3输入nums [-1,1,-1,1,-1] 输出-1 解释数组中所有值的乘积是 -1 且 signFunc(-1) -1提示 1 nums.length 1000-100 nums[i] 100 解题思路 因为函数 signFunc(x) 将会根据 x 的正负返回特定值而我们需要返回的结果为 signFunc(product)(product 为数组 nums 中所有元素值的乘积),所以我们不需要关心我们最后乘积的大小我们只需要关心乘积的正负号。因此我们只需要处理 一旦出现为0的元素那么整个结果必将为0所以我们可以直接返回0不需要进行后面的计算一旦出现负数将原来的符号置为相反数,如果原来为1则转化为-1.如果原来为-1则转换为1.如果遇到的是正数对当前的符号没有影响因此不需要做任何的处理一开始初始化的符号应该为1 代码 class Solution { public:int arraySign(vectorint nums) {int sum1;for (auto c:nums) {if (c0) return 0;if (c0) sum-sum;}return sum;} };时间复杂度Onn为nums数组的长度空间复杂度O1只需要使用一个变量表示符号
http://www.yutouwan.com/news/169321/

相关文章:

  • 张掖网站制作网址导航类网站如何做推广
  • 搬瓦工做网站稳定吗鹤岗手机网站建设
  • 洛宁网站建设做网站怎么租个空间
  • 如何做好网站推广优化十大电脑必玩大型免费网游
  • 大连网站制作 姚喜运旅游网站代码html
  • 网站功能建设模块iis7 发布静态网站
  • 成都网站建设3六六百度云无法进入wordpress
  • 搜索引擎优化网站的网址网站qq交谈怎么做的
  • 均安网站制作免费网站模板 优帮云
  • 长春做网站搜吉网传媒陕西网站关键词自然排名优化
  • 沈阳专业网站制作百度网站安全在线检测
  • 怎么开通网站和进行网页设计手工活外发
  • 邯郸市教育考试院官网宁波seo推广推荐公司
  • 临沂建设规划局网站菏泽建设局官网
  • 广告网站留电话不用验证码wordpress分享插件积分
  • 有哪些好的网站制作公司网站建设谢辞
  • 网站代理最快最干净怎么制作软件平台
  • 哪里有配音的网站上海装修公司前十强
  • 哈尔滨搭建网站成都logo设计公司
  • 毕业设计代做网站 知乎58同城招聘网 找工作
  • 温州机械网站建设seo下载站
  • 沧州网站优化公司达州市做网站
  • 十堰网站建设怎么样宜春招聘网站开发区招工
  • 兰州网站seo外包官网网站备案流程图
  • 网站两列导航商城网站定制怎么做
  • 律师网站深圳网站设计淘宝客的优惠卷网站怎么做的
  • 中原郑州网站建设帮忙注册公司
  • 多元网站建设部网站核对编号
  • 设计网站的功能有哪些内容教人做家务的网站
  • 网站设计公司排名知乎discuz整合wordpress